Sanju Samson’s father breaks down in tears, video goes viral
An emotional moment unfolded after Indian cricketer Sanju Samson produced one of the most memorable innings of his career in the ongoing ICC Men's T20 World Cup 2026. Following his heroic performance against the West Indies national cricket team, Samson’s father was seen breaking down in tears, revealing how deeply the moment meant to the family after years of struggle and criticism.
Prayers For Son
Speaking emotionally after the match, Samson’s father said he had been watching the game without distraction until the final ball. In an emotional statement, he said he prayed for his son’s dignity and one special day on the field.
“Main kal subah 6 baje se last ball tak baitha raha. Maine kisi ka phone nahi uthaya. Bas Bhagwan se yahi maanga — uski izzat bacha lo aur usse ek din de do. Maine pehli baar Bhagwan se kuch maanga,” he said.

The emotional reaction came after Samson delivered a stunning match-winning knock that powered the India national cricket team into the semi-finals of the tournament. In a high-pressure Super 8 clash played at Eden Gardens in Kolkata, India were chasing a daunting target of 196 runs set by the West Indies. Samson rose to the occasion with a breathtaking unbeaten 97 off just 50 balls, smashing 12 boundaries and four sixes.

His innings guided India to 199/5 in 19.2 overs, sealing a dramatic five-wicket victory and securing a place in the semi-finals of the World Cup. The knock was not only match-winning but also historic. Samson’s 97* became the highest individual score by an Indian batter in a successful T20 World Cup run chase, surpassing earlier records set by Virat Kohli.
For years, Samson had faced criticism over inconsistency and limited opportunities at the international level. However, his fearless strokeplay and composure under pressure in this crucial match have now turned him into one of India’s biggest heroes in the tournament.
